Garin Surname Meaning and Etymology

The surname Garin is believed to have originated from the Italianization of the Germanic name Warin, or in some cases, even from a modification of the medieval Lombard names Garo and Gairulf. The name has different variations that are specific to certain regions, indicating its diverse roots and historical significance.

Garin and its Variants

The family name Garino is typically Piemontese, widely found in the areas of Turin and Cuneo, with a presence in Liguria as well. Garin is characteristic of the province of Aosta and Turin, while Garini is prevalent in southern Lombardy, including Pavia, Lodi, Cremona, and Mantua. The surname Garrini, although rare, is specifically associated with Mantuan, while Garrino is typical of Turin and Chieri in the Turin vicinity.

The Vasco Origin of Garin

In Basque, the surname Garin holds the meaning "Del trigo" or "pedregal chico", as described in various sources, highlighting the linguistic diversity and cultural significance associated with the name. The Basque connection adds another layer to the complex etymology of Garin, suggesting its roots in different regions and languages.

Furthermore, the old French term "garnison" is mentioned in connection with the surname, potentially as a nickname for a man-at-arms or as a former Germanic baptismal name derived from the word for lance. The complexities of Garin's etymology extend to its potential ties to the name Guérin, emphasizing the rich history and evolution of the surname over time.

Exploring the Origins of Garin

As an ancient Germanic baptismal name, Garin may represent the southern form of Gerin or a dialectal variation of Warin, with associations to "gari" meaning lance and "waran" signifying protection. The diminutive form Garinot and connections to the name Gelin further illustrate the depth of Garin's etymology and the various influences shaping its meaning.
